The Henry Repeating Arms H1 Sporter Carbine in .22 Magnum is a lever-action rifle built for shooters who value reliability, handling, and practical accuracy in a lightweight package. With its 16.5-inch barrel and compact 34.5-inch overall length, this carbine excels as a versatile rimfire for target work, small-game hunting, and casual range sessions—all while remaining easy to carry and quick to aim. Henry's reputation for quality manufacturing shines through in the H1 Sporter: a blued steel barrel paired with a classically styled American walnut stock featuring a checkered pistol grip and Monte Carlo comb deliver both durability and that satisfying feel that makes lever guns fun to shoot.
The 10-round capacity keeps you in the field or at the range longer between reloads, and the .22 Magnum cartridge offers noticeably more velocity and energy than standard .22 LR, making it an effective choice for small game out to moderate distances. At just 5.35 pounds, the H1 Sporter won't wear you down during a day of shooting. The integrated Picatinny rail accommodates modern optics easily, so you can mount a scope or red dot without gunsmithing—though the open iron sights are plenty adequate for the rifle's intended use.
Practical details matter here: the 1/4-cock safety keeps your finger safe in the field, and the 1:16 rifling twist is optimized for .22 Magnum performance. The threaded 1/2×28 barrel (covered by a cap) hints at suppressor compatibility for those interested in quieter shooting. Whether you're introducing someone to lever guns, heading out for rabbits and prairie dogs, or just enjoying an afternoon punching paper, the Henry H1 Sporter Carbine is a no-nonsense, time-tested choice.
| Action Type | Lever Action |
| Caliber | .22 Magnum |
| Capacity | 10 Rounds |
| Barrel Length | 16.5 inches |
| Overall Length | 34.5 inches |
| Weight | 5.35 lbs |
| Barrel Finish | Blued Steel |
| Receiver Finish | Black |
| Rifling Twist | 1:16 |
| Stock Material | American Walnut |
| Stock Style | Checkered Pistol Grip, Monte Carlo |
| Length of Pull | 14 inches |
| Barrel Threading | 1/2×28 |
| Optic Mount | Integrated Picatinny Rail |
| Safety | 1/4 Cock |
